Analysis
San Marino recorded 0.9641 GPI for gross enrolment ratio, primary to tertiary, gender parity index in 2019.
The figure is up 0.8% on the previous year and down 12.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, gross enrolment ratio, primary to tertiary, gender parity index in San Marino peaked at 1.14 GPI in 2000 and was at its lowest, 0.9567 GPI, in 2018.
That places San Marino 137th out of 173 countries with data for 2019, putting it in the bottom quarter.

About this data
Ratio of female gross enrolment ratio for primary to tertiary to the male value for the same indicator. It is calculated by dividing the female value for the indicator by the male value for the indicator. A GPI equal to 1 indicates parity between females and males. In general, a value less than 1 indicates disparity in favor of males and a value greater than 1 indicates disparity in favor of females.
